Ubud Monkey Forest
Enter a dense rain forest full of banyan trees and flowing streams to visit ancient Hindu temples and baths and see agile macaques swing in the treetops.

Goa Gajah
This mysterious place just outside of Ubud houses a Hindu temple, statues, ponds and fountains from a time gone by.

Agung Rai Museum of Art
Immerse yourself in Balinese culture at this interactive centre, enjoy a meal, or stay in the resort and relax in the peaceful natural setting.

Neka Art Museum
This impressive art museum is home to some of the most influential artists in Bali and gives insight into the development of Balinese art.

Blanco Museum
This extravagant hilltop retreat with gardens was once the home of “the Dali of Bali”, the man many consider to be the island’s most eccentric artist.
